I did make my 2 week mini-goal, however, I changed it. I know that sounds weird. Let me 'splain.
After a lot of reading and research, I realized I was not lifting enough weight during my strength training days (2 days a week). This is a common mistake that women make. Also, I realized that I do not have to increase my cardio the way I was thinking.
SOOOO, I am sticking with the regimen of walking/jogging/running
(depending on snow, and my energy level) 3.5 miles, 5 days per week. AND, I started using this ancient Bowflex my husband bought many moons ago. I feel safe using more weight on the Bowflex, as it is harder to seriously hurt myself. Therefore, I'm able to do fewer reps at a higher weight which is an effective way to strength train.
